Ragnor Barakos could never understand why he was so much taller and larger than his friends and family. He lusted for battle more than anyone else in the village. It was all a mystery to the young man until the day his parents sat him down. A village warrior and a tailor raised him from the time he was only a year or two old. Ragnor didn't remember anything of his past, only pain.

"There was a large battle son." his father began to tell him. "The villages across this part of Sosaria banded together to invade a common enemy. They we called barbarians, vicious people, with the strength of two men. They were beganning to push they way towards the villages and we're taking the roads as their own. We couldn't trade between towns anymore, and it was becoming hard living you see. We knew we wouldn't beable to take the barbarians on with even numbers, they were trained to fight from birth."

Ragnor listened carefully as his father described the advance the villagers made towards the barbarians. In a sense he felt deeply sorry for the tribe, but couldn't figure out why.

"The tribe and the villagers fought for hours you see. Until finally we overwhelmed them and defeated them. A few got away but they never showed their faces around here. Son, we found you in a tent sleeping when the battle finished. We brought you home and raised you."

It all made sense to him now. They reason he was so much bigger, his lust for battle, his temper and pride. Unlike most barbarians Ragnor didn't wield an axe or a war hammer, he was a fencer. It seemed almost comical when this large man swung about a kryss, it looked almost like a dagger in his hands. None the less he could wield it better than anyone else in the village.

After a long discussion with his parents he understood there was so much more for him outside the village. Soon after he packed his things headed out. His father told him stories of militias around the lands. Alot were dispurse now, but one held strong "The Sanctus Militia" - just outside Luna. He figured he'd give it a go.

Ragnor didn't know what exactly he was really looking for. Perhaps more answers, or perhaps a reason to fight - for virtues. He didn't quite know what he'd do if he ever came across another barbarian. Deep down he wanted to meet the kin that got away from the villagers. But for another reason he knew it was best to stay far away from them.
